Popis: Delayed afterdepolarizations (DADs) induced by the electrogenic Na/Ca exchanger (NCX) play an important role in the genesis of arrhythmias. However, it is not known whether the NCX-induced DADs play any role in the genesis of the repolarization prolonging drug-induced torsades de pointes ventricular tachycardia (TdP). Therefore, the present study examined the effect of the selective inhibition of NCX (by SEA0400) on the occurrence of dofetilide-induced TdP in isolated, Langendorff-perfused, AV-blocked rabbit hearts. A group of hearts was perfused with 100 nM dofetilide, another group was perfused with the combination of 1 μM SEA0400 and 100 nM dofetilide, and a control group of hearts was perfused with the solvent DMSO. Each group contained n=8 hearts. Volume conducted ECG was recorded and the incidence and the onset times of TdPs were analyzed subsequently.
